AbstractRefreshableApplicationContext是Spring框架中的一个抽象类,用于表示可刷新的应用上下文。

该接口继承了ConfigurableApplicationContext接口,并添加了refresh()方法和setConfigLocation()方法。refresh()方法用于刷新应用上下文,即重新加载配置文件并更新容器状态。setConfigLocation()方法用于设置应用上下文的配置文件路径。

AbstractRefreshableApplicationContext还定义了一些抽象方法,如loadBeanDefinitions()和getConfigLocations(),这些方法在具体的子类中实现,用于加载和解析配置文件。

该接口的实现类包括GenericApplicationContext和GenericWebApplicationContext等。通过实现该接口,可以创建自定义的可刷新应用上下文,以满足特定的应用需求。

spring AbstractRefreshableApplicationContext接口说明

原文地址: https://www.cveoy.top/t/topic/fhrK 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录